Login
网站首页 > 文章中心 > 其它

html的js调用php函数_php函数的调用等于转化为html文本

作者:小编 更新时间:2023-08-03 12:31:34 浏览量:74人看过

html调用js,js再调用php,然后在网页显示调用结果

建议使用jquery

给查询两个字加一个标签,比如a标签:a href="#" class="chaxun"查询/a

然后写jquery的ajax代码:

html的js调用php函数_php函数的调用等于转化为html文本-图1

biaohao = $('#bianhao').val();//取得文本框id为bianhao的值

mingzhi = $('#mingzi').val();//同理

});

最后在你的chaxun.php中,和平时写代码一样就行了

php

$bianhao = $_GET['bianhao'];

$mingzhi = $_GET['mingzhi'];

//接着就是你的数据库查询

echo $Data;//输出你的数据库查询结果即可

html用js获取php文件报错

用javascript形式输出数据,其实那就是php把js的输出脚本变为字符串的形式,当js调用会执行php代码

例如:输出的php文件demo.php

echo 'document.write("'.define('WP_USE_THEMES', false);.'")';

echo 'document.write("'.require('article/wp-blog-header.php');.'")';

其它的都是这样写就行了

html页面js调用demo.php

script type="text/javascript" src="demo.php"/script

如何在js中调用php

js是浏览端脚本,PHP 是服务器端的,也就是说,浏览器里的js不能真正调用php.

但可以通过http request方式触发php方法并得到response

// server.php

$name = $_POST["name"];

$password = $_POST["password"];

$result = loginUser($name, $password);

echo $result;

//client.html

form action="server.php" method="POST"

input type="text" name="name"

input type="text" name="password"

input type="submit" value="Login" /

form

// or in js

var name = $("[name='name']");

var password= $("[name='password']");

$.ajax({

url: 'server.php'

method:'post',

data: {

name: name,

password: password

}

})

.done(function(result){...})

html中利用js调用php文件输出文本

这个得看具体情况了.要是使用ajax的话,是不可以跨域访问的,也就是说这个php文件和前台页面要在一个域名下.

跨域的话,可以使用动态脚本来获得,不过可能就得改一下php的输出,变成var news=........这样可以被js正常解析的形式.

不清楚你的具体情况.

在HTML页面使用JS调用PHP动态页信息

说实话没见过这种用法,html js 调用php动态页面,一般都用ajax吧

以上就是土嘎嘎小编为大家整理的html的js调用php函数相关主题介绍,如果您觉得小编更新的文章只要能对粉丝们有用,就是我们最大的鼓励和动力,不要忘记讲本站分享给您身边的朋友哦!!

版权声明:倡导尊重与保护知识产权。未经许可,任何人不得复制、转载、或以其他方式使用本站《原创》内容,违者将追究其法律责任。本站文章内容,部分图片来源于网络,如有侵权,请联系我们修改或者删除处理。

编辑推荐

热门文章